Chemical Properties

PropertySpecification
Pka5-7
Ionic NatureNon-ionic
IncompatibilitiesStrong acids and alkalis in high concentrations can cause hydrolysis and loss of viscosity. Divalent and trivalent ions (e.g., Ca²⁺, Al³⁺) can cause viscosity changes or gel formation.
Hazardous Reactions / Decomposition ProductsDecomposes upon prolonged heating.

Thermal Properties

PropertySpecification
Melting PointDoes not have a specific melting point as it is a polysaccharide and decomposes upon heating.
Decomposition TemperatureTypically begins to decompose around 200°C to 250°C.
Thermal StabilityStable up to 80°C (176°F) for five minutes. Degrades at extreme pH and temperature (e.g., pH 3 at 50°C).

Dosing Guidelines

A. Dosing by Application

ApplicationRecommended / Max Dosage
General Food Products0.1% to 1.0%
Beverages2 g to 10 g per L
Baked Goods0.1% to 1.0%
Sauces and Dressings0.1% to 1.0%
Ice Cream / Dairy Products0.1% to 1.0%
Instant Noodles0.3% to 0.5%
Cheese ProductsUp to 3% of total weight

About Guar Gum

Guar gum, also known as guaran, is a natural galactomannan polysaccharide derived from guar beans. This versatile ingredient is highly valued for its thickening and stabilizing properties, making it ideal for a variety of applications in food, feed, and industrial sectors. At Elchemy, we pride ourselves on being leading guar gum producers, offering high-quality products that meet stringent industry standards.


Our guar gum is carefully produced through a meticulous process. The guar seeds are mechanically dehusked, hydrated, milled, and screened to achieve a fine, free-flowing, off-white powder. This powder is not only effective as a thickening agent but also serves multiple roles, including gelling, clouding, and binding. In the food industry, it enhances texture and stability while preserving and emulsifying ingredients. Additionally, it helps improve water retention and boosts the fiber content in various formulations.

Regulatory Compliance

RegionMax Allowed LevelNotesCertification Body
Australia-Permitted as a food additive.FSANZ approval
Canada-Permitted for use as a food additive.Health Canada approval
India-Approved for use in food products.FSSAI, GMP
United States2%Generally Recognized As Safe (GRAS).FDA (adherence to 21 CFR 184.1339), GMP
European Union-Approved food additive (E412).REACH, EFSA approval

FAQs - Guar Gum

How does guar gum compare to xanthan gum in cooking and baking?
Both guar gum and xanthan gum are thickeners and stabilizers commonly used in cooking and baking. While they share similar properties, guar gum is derived from guar beans, and xanthan gum is produced through bacterial fermentation. Some people prefer one over the other based on personal preferences and dietary considerations.
Does guar gum have any nutritional benefits?
Guar gum itself is low in calories and does not provide significant nutritional benefits. However, it is often used to improve the texture of foods and can contribute to the overall sensory experience of a product without adding a substantial amount of calories or nutrients.
Is guar gum safe for children?
Guar gum is generally considered safe for consumption by children when used in approved amounts. However, parents should be mindful of potential allergic reactions or digestive issues.
Is guar gum a natural ingredient?
Yes, guar gum is considered a natural ingredient as it is derived from the ground endosperm of guar beans. It is often used as an alternative to synthetic thickeners and stabilizers.
Can guar gum cause digestive issues?
In some individuals, consuming large amounts of guar gum may cause gastrointestinal discomfort, bloating, gas, or diarrhea. However, it is generally well-tolerated in small to moderate quantities.
